How to create your own custom merch

  1. Learn about your audience.
  2. Brainstorm cool merch ideas.
  3. Design and mock up your products.
  4. Find a manufacturer or print-on-demand partner.
  5. Generate word of mouth.
  6. Leverage your existing channels.
  7. Sell on marketplaces.
  8. Retarget your existing audience.

Then, What is merchandise designing? Merchandising includes the determination of quantities, setting prices for goods, creating display designs, developing marketing strategies, and establishing discounts or coupons. More broadly, merchandising may refer to retail sales itself: the provision of goods to end-user consumers.

How much money do you need to start a clothing line?

Startup costs can vary greatly across different clothing lines, but in general, a small-sized clothing line will need a minimum of $500 to get started, a medium-sized line should have between $1,000 to $5,000 for startup costs and a large line will need approximately $25,000 to $50,000 upfront.

How much does it cost to put a logo on a shirt?

When calculating your T-shirt printing cost, factoring in quantity is key. If you’re purchasing a small number, you can expect to pay retail prices – think $20-$30 per shirt. Now, this price point may be just fine if you’re looking to make a T-shirt for yourself.

How much does a merch designer make?

Salaries can range from $32,302 – $157,126. When factoring in additional pay and benefits, Merchandise Designer in United States can expect their total pay value to be on average $68,109.

What is an example of merchandising business?

There are many examples of merchandising businesses. Some of them include clothing stores, drug stores, and grocery stores. These businesses sell goods and employ tactics such as special offers and good display to attract customers.

How much do artists make from merchandise?

Most artists receive a percentage of the sale of their merch – around 30% or so is pretty common, at least in the US, though the rate can fluctuate depending on your star power. This percentage is commonly taken from gross sales of your merch – that is sales minus taxes, and credit card fees.

How do I trademark my logo?

Trademark Application Process:

  1. Complete a trademark search.
  2. Secure your rights.
  3. Submit an initial application at uspto.gov on the Trademark Electronic Application System or TEAS.
  4. Fill out the TEAS form for an initial application. Be sure to upload the file of your logo.
  5. Submit an “intent-to-use” form.
  6. Pay the fees.

How much should I charge for a logo design 2021?

Beginners can set a price of $200-800 on average, while the work of experienced professionals can cost $800-2000. The time spent on the project is important (ask about the rate, i.e. hourly or per project) as well as the number of iterations.
